DescriptionA data warehouse powered by Apache HAWQ supporting descriptive analysis and advanced machine learningSADAS Engine is a columnar DBMS specifically designed for high performance in data warehouse environmentsAnalytics Platform for Big DataTypeDB is a strongly-typed database with a rich and logical type system and TypeQL as its query language
Primary database modelRelational DBMSRelational DBMSSearch engineGraph DBMS
Relational DBMS infoOften described as a 'hyper-relational' database, since it implements the 'Entity-Relationship Paradigm' to manage complex data structures and ontologies.
